📖 What is Applied Physics?
Applied Physics is the branch of physics that applies fundamental laws to practical problems, distinct from pure physics which explores theoretical concepts. Its meaning encompasses engineering-like applications in areas such as photonics, biomaterials, and quantum computing. For an Instructor, this translates to teaching courses that prepare students for industries like semiconductors and medical imaging.
Historically, Applied Physics gained prominence after World War II, driven by needs in electronics and materials science. Today, it powers advancements like AI-driven simulations, as seen in recent developments revolutionizing robotics.
Definitions
- Photonics: The science of light generation, detection, and manipulation, crucial for fiber optics and lasers.
- Nanotechnology: Engineering at the atomic scale (1-100 nanometers) to create materials with novel properties, like stronger composites.
- Semiconductors: Materials with electrical conductivity between conductors and insulators, foundational to electronics and solar cells.
🎯 Key Responsibilities
Instructors in Applied Physics design syllabi, lead lectures, and oversee labs where students build circuits or analyze data. They also advise on capstone projects, grade assessments, and stay current with trends like sustainable energy tech. This role demands enthusiasm for mentoring, as students often transition to tech careers.
📊 Required Academic Qualifications, Expertise, and Skills
To secure Instructor jobs in Applied Physics, candidates need solid credentials tailored to teaching excellence.
Required Academic Qualifications
- Master's degree in Applied Physics, Physics, or related field (PhD strongly preferred for senior roles).
- Coursework in core areas like electromagnetism and thermodynamics.
Research Focus or Expertise Needed
- Specialization in practical domains such as optics, condensed matter, or computational physics.
- Experience with tools like MATLAB or COMSOL for modeling.
Preferred Experience
- Prior teaching as a teaching assistant or adjunct.
- Publications (2-5 peer-reviewed) and small grants demonstrating applied impact.
Skills and Competencies
- Excellent communication to simplify quantum mechanics applications.
- Lab safety and equipment handling proficiency.
- Adaptability to diverse student backgrounds and online platforms.
